Treating Injuries after the Accident
The first and most important job of an accident injury doctor is to find out what injuries you have. Medical help provided right away after the accident can save you from long term medical problems. Even if you don’t feel much pain right after the accident, some symptoms can take hours or even days to appear.
Car accidents can result in injuries like neck or back pain, broken bones, heavy bleeding, or even nerve damage. These doctors use physical exams and imaging tests, such as X-rays or MRIs, to determine what’s wrong. Their goal is to catch injuries early so that treatment can begin right away.

Helps You with Legal Claims and Insurance
After a car accident, you don’t just have to face medical problems but financial problems regarding your vehicle as well, and a car accident injury doctor can help you with this matter, too. One important part of an accident injury doctor’s job is documentation. This means they carefully record your injuries, treatment, and progress in your medical file.
They use these medical records to file for an insurance claim and to work easily with the legal team.
Having proper medical documentation helps prove that your injuries were caused by the accident. This can make a big difference in how much compensation you receive for medical bills.
